47 killed, wounded in car bomb attack in Ghazni province of Afghanistan
[KhaamaPress] A car kaboom killed or maimed at least 47 people in South-eastern Ghazni province of Afghanistan, the provincial government said.
According to a statement released by Provincial Governor’s Office, the holy warriors detonated a Humvee Armored Personnel Carrier in Saqafat area of Ghazni city at around 4:40 am local time.
The statement further added that the attack which targeted the 703 Special Unit of the Afghan intelligence, killed 7 people and maimed at least 40 others.
The explosion also damaged many homes as far as 2 kilometres away from the site of the earth-shattering kaboom, the statement said, adding that 8 of the maimed individuals are at death's door.
